English

English is designed to develop students’ analytical, critical and communicative skills.  It encourages students to explore texts of different kinds in relation to the cultures that produced them.  It allows students to discover the scope of the discipline as it is practised worldwide today.

Choices include the following:

  • Creative Writing
  • Shakespeare and Early Modern Literature and Culture
  • Victorian Literature and Culture
  • Children’s Literature
  • Modern and Contemporary Literatures and Cultures
  • Literature and Film
  • Australian and Postcolonial Literatures and Cultures
  • Feminism and Literature
  • Narrative.
